Product Overview

Comprehensive evaluation kit for 8.95 MP monochrome sensor with high resolution and serial sLVDS support.

The Sony IMX267LLR Evaluation Board Kit offers a complete solution to evaluate the 8.95 MP monochrome CMOS image sensor. It includes all necessary components, such as the Sensor Driver Board, Interface Board, and Lens Mount mechanism (no lens included), plus a CD containing software and documentation to facilitate setup. Supporting serial sLVDS data interfaces and compatible with C/CS mount optics, this EVB kit is ideal for applications in industrial inspection, surveillance, and scientific imaging. Its high-resolution monochrome imaging capabilities make it well-suited for environments requiring precise data capture in grayscale, such as machine vision and scientific analysis. The IMX267LLR sensor's excellent dynamic range and fast readout ensure superior performance in demanding applications, while the evaluation board simplifies the process of sensor testing and integration. This comprehensive kit allows engineers and developers to explore the sensor's full potential, improving overall efficiency and reducing development time for projects requiring monochrome imaging.
